Macy's

Macy's, a popular department store chain in America is well-known. The company is headquartered in New York City and is famous for its annual Thanksgiving Day parade and 4th of July fireworks show. The store has a variety of different locations throughout the country, but is most well-known for its flagship location in Herald Square.

Established in 1858, Macy's is one of the most well-known department stores in the world. Macy's is synonymous with a wide variety of services and products, including upscale clothing, cosmetics, home goods, and furniture. In addition to its traditional brick and mortar stores the retailer has also expanded its reach online and into other markets. Macy's unlike other department stores, offers free shipping and returns to all customers.

The company has made substantial investments in its e-commerce business. It has introduced new features like Shop by Product and Store Pickup. Macy's also has a number exclusive and carefully selected brands that are that are only available at the retail giant. Macy's has also implemented sophisticated support systems to assist customers navigate its mobile and online apps as well as its website.

In the early 2000s, Macy's merged with a number of regional department stores including Lazarus, Filene's, Marshalls, and Bloomingdale's to create Federated Department Stores, Inc. The resultant company was the largest department store chain in the US with 810 stores across the United States.

Belk

Belk is an American department store chain. It offers fashion apparel, accessories, footwear, beauty and home furnishings under private labels and Designer Handbags On Sale Cheap branded brands. Its headquarters are in Charlotte, North Carolina. The company's goal is to provide customers with an experience that is personal to them, including in-store and online. It also offers a broad range of services, such as alterations and gift wrapping. The private label brands it has include Belk & Co, Crown & Ivy, Kaari Blue, Kim Rogers, Madison, New Directions, Ocean & Coast, Pro Tour and Saddlebred.

In addition to its shoes, clothing, and cosmetics lines, Belk offers a large selection of designer handbags names handbags. Customers and celebrities alike are awestruck by these bags. Some of the designers featured in Belk's stores include Ralph Lauren, Tommy Hilfiger and Calvin Klein. Some are more affordable, like Jessica Simpson and Lilly Pulitzer. Belk sells bags from popular brands like Coach Michael Kors and Jessica Simpson, in addition to the luxury designers.

The Belk company was established in 1888 as a small, family-owned business. After 1910, the company's growth accelerated by adding new locations in the South. By 1930 the company was operating a network of more than 100 stores. Belk was a constant presence in its markets, despite fierce competition from mega-discounters, as well as numerous multi-billion dollar bankruptcy cases in the early 1990s.

After the death of founder William Henry Belk, his sons took over and transformed the business from bargain stores in the downtown area to modern fashion destinations in malls and shopping centers. In 1998, the business changed its name to Belk Inc. and in 2010, it launched the new logo and tagline: "Modern." Southern. Style."

Belk as well as its retail business has also a variety of shopping centers across the Southeast. Its headquarters are in Charlotte, North Carolina. It also has more than 300 shops. Fashionista

Fashionphile is a prestigious resale company that offers an extensive selection of designer handbags. The collection includes a variety of brands, including Louis Vuitton and Chanel. The company also sells more affordable bags, which makes it possible for anyone to change their style. Visit their website frequently for new products.

The website is easy-to-use and lets users create a profile to track their most-loved products. Customers can also set up alerts for items that are sold out or are on sale. Fashionphile is a firm believer on authenticity. All bags are put through a rigorous test process to ensure they are authentic. They employ a team of experts who are educated in the art of authenticating. The company is committed to offering top-quality products and exceptional customer service.

FASHIONPHILE was founded in 1999 and was the first ultra-luxury company to resell its products. Sarah Davis is the founder of FASHIONPHILE. She was a law student and former lawyer who established the company in 1999 with just an idea. In 2006, Davis enlisted business partner and CEO Ben Hemminger who has taken the company to the next level by expanding its product line and presenting it a wider public.

Apart from its wide collection of designer bags, Fashionphile is known for its strict policy on authenticity. The authenticity of every item is checked by a group of experts. If there is any doubt, the product is rejected. This ensures that the business sells only authentic, high-quality products.
